Forms

Purpose:

The Forms Committee shall work with Georgia Association of REALTORS® legal counsel in the development and revision of real estate related forms deemed appropriate for use by REALTOR® Board Members, Member Boards, and board owned/operated multiple listing services.

Composition: 

Number on Committee: Twelve 
Chairman: Appointed by the President 
Vice Chairman: Appointed by the President-Elect 
Makeup: Twelve At-Large members, including at least one member who holds the RLI designation and one member who holds the CCIM designation or is a representative of the commercial brokerage community. The President and President-Elect are ex-officio members.
Restrictions: N/A

Term: Two years (staggered)

Limits: No member may serve more than six consecutive years

Quorum: Five

Reporting: Vice President of Governmental Affairs, Executive Committee, Board of Directors

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Shall develop and revise real estate-related forms on an as needed basis. (Note: Without the prior approval of the Executive Committee, legal fees associated with the development of new forms shall be limited by the annual operating budget.)
  • Shall seek the endorsement of the Georgia Real Estate Commission and the Georgia Bar Association on the Georgia Association of REALTORS® forms whenever possible
  • All requests for funds are to be channeled through the Finance Committee for inclusion in its report to the Executive Committee as to the budgeting impact of such funds requests
  • Shall perform such other duties as directed by the Board of Directors, the Executive Committee or the President
